quote:
Any of you boys use a red dot duck hunting? Just wondering how y’all like it if you do.
It would make shooting a bird in flight incredibly difficult, as it essentially narrows your view, slows reaction time, and flies in the face of all field gunning principles for shotguns.
If you are shooting ducks off the water, turkeys, or doves off of power lines or tree limbs, sure, have at it.
But an impractical choice for bird hunting.

quote:
It would make shooting a bird in flight incredibly difficult, as it essentially narrows your view, slows reaction time, and flies in the face of all field gunning principles for shotguns.
That wasn't my experience with it at all. The frame of the sight was so thin that you never even noticed it was there. You have both eyes open focusing on the target so you never see the frame of the sight only the red dot which appears to be floating well in front of the shotgun. The sight picture you see is a duck flying and your thinking I see the duck and there is a red dot flying right in front of him.
